They are also affordable
A stand alone bioethanol fireplace is a cost-effective alternative to traditional wood-burning fireplaces. Bioethanol fireplaces don't require chimneys or flues, so they are an ideal choice for homeowners with only a small space. They are simple to install and operate. Many are designed to look like traditional stoves and fireplaces and some are portable so you can move them from room to room, or take them outside.
The price of a standalone bioethanol fireplace is determined by the size and design that you choose. Most commonly, you'll find prefab wall-mounted units in the $300-$5,600 range and custom-built units priced from $2,000 to $9,500. They can be hung on the wall, similar to a flat-screen TV or placed in the wall to give them a more discrete appearance. Most of these models have mounting hardware, so you can hang them yourself or hire a professional to hang them for you.
Bioethanol fireplaces, unlike natural gas, are less expensive in the long run. They don't generate as much heat, however they provide enough to keep your room warm. Plus there's no ash or soot to worry about. They are also much easier than wood-burning fire places to clean.
Bioethanol fires are easy to installed, as they don't require chimneys or an electrical connection. You simply need to fill the flame with bioethanol fuel, then light it. Remember that these fireplaces can be flame-resistant. Keep them out of reach of combustibles and children. In addition, it's best to keep the fuel in a cool place and avoid pouring it into the fire while the flame is still on.
The bioethanol fireplace can add warmth and class to any room of your home. They are great for small homes, apartments, or condos. They also make a great alternative for gas or electric fireplaces. They aren't as effective at heating large spaces. They might be better suited for smaller spaces like living rooms or bedrooms.
These fireplaces are not as warm as a wood-burning fire, but they make stunning accent pieces in any room. You can put them outdoors in your garden or on your patio.
